HELP MEEEE Distances in space are measured in light-years. The distance from Earth to a star is 6.8 × 10^13 kilometers. What is the distance, in light-years, from Earth to the star (1 light-year = 9.46 × 10^12 kilometers)?

Answers

  1. Answer:
    ≈ 7.188 LY
    Step-by-step explanation:
    1 LY = 9.46 * 10¹²
    S = 6.8 * 10¹³
    S = 6.8 * 10¹³/9.46 * 10¹² ≈ 7.188 LY
